Epidemiological Status U.P. 2009-10Epidemiological Status U.P. 2009-10

Population of U.P. :- 20,37,63,851

Leprosy cases at end of March 2010 :- 16,484

New case detection from 1st April 2009 to 31st March 2010 :- 27,473

ANCDR per 1,00,000 popul.

Prev. Rate per 10,000 popul. as on 01.04.

2010

Child Rate among New

Cases (In %)

Deform-ity Rate Among New Cases

(In Gr. II %)

%age of MB among New

Cases Detected (In %)

%age of Female among

New cases( In %)

13.48276 0.808976 5.987697 2.162123 38.97645 31.54006

Major Problems Identified in the District in NLEP ProgrammeMajor Problems Identified in the District in NLEP Programme

S.No.

Problems Suggestions

1. DPMR forms are not available in HCFs of all districts. Even available in districts , NMSs & NMAs of HCFs do not know to fill up the forms correctly.

DLOs have been requested for printing & distribution of DPMR forms but they complain of shortage of Budget etc. SLO may kindly look into it. DLO / DN in NLEP monthly meetings should demonstrate ST, VMT & filling of DPMR forms.

2. DN Staff do not get vehicle for Supervision in periphery where as 01 vehicle on road is available with DLO, so Supervision is weak.

DLOs are requested to spare NLEP vehicle to DN staff for Supervision when they are working in office & not going to field.

3. Knowledge of NLEP / GHC Staff is weak in POD & Self Care.

Workshop on POD & Self Care in villages to be organised in all the districts.

4. Healthy Contact Examination is not done in every District of Lucknow zone.

DLO & DN on his Supervision should see that Healthy Contact Examination of every cases is done.

Page 22: Quarterly Progress Report

22

Major Problems Identified in the District in NLEP ProgrammeMajor Problems Identified in the District in NLEP Programme

S.No.

Problems Suggestions

5. ST & VMT is not done in every District. ST & VMT to be demonstrated to NLEP Staff in their monthly meetings. Most of the NLEP Staff do not know about correct VMT.

6. ATP is prepared by all Districts but Supervision report & Validation report is neither prepared nor sent to SLO in few districts.

DLOs are requested to prepare ATP every month & Visit to be made as per ATP. Supervision & Validation report to be sent to SLO regularly.

7. Validation of Cases is poor. Validation of cases to be improved by DN.

8. Referral Unit is established in all 07 Districts of Lucknow zone but cases are not referred from periphery to referral unit in all districts.

DLO / DN should make wide publicity about constitution of referral unit in District Hospital among all HCFs & NLEP Staff.
